Creating Your Free Printable Employee Schedules
Creating your free printable employee schedules involves a few simple steps. First, you'll need to gather some basic information about your employees and their availability. This may include their names, contact details, preferred working hours, and any scheduling constraints such as vacation time or recurring days off.

Once you have this information, you can begin designing your schedule template. There are numerous free templates available online that you can customize to fit your business needs. Alternatively, you can create your own template using spreadsheet software like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ets.
Designing Your Schedule Template

When designing your schedule template, consider including the following elements:
- Employee Name: Include a column for employee names to ensure everyone is accounted for.
- Date: Add a row or column for dates to cover the scheduling period (e.g., a week or a month).
- Shift Times: Create columns for different shift times to indicate when employees are scheduled to work.
- Notes/Comments: Include a column for notes or comments to accommodate any special requests, training sessions, or other relevant information.
You can also customize your template by adding colors, using different fonts, or including your company logo to make it more visually appealing and professional.

Customizing Your Schedule Template
After creating your basic template, you can customize it to fit your business's specific needs. For instance, you might want to include different shift types (e.g., full-time, part-time, or on-call) or accommodate specific employee roles and responsibilities.
To make the most of your free printable employee schedules, consider the following customization options:

- Shift Patterns: Create recurring shift patterns for employees with consistent schedules.
- Color-Coding: Use different colors for different shifts, departments, or employee roles to make the schedule easier to read.
- Time-Off Requests: Include a section for employees to request time off, ensuring you have adequate staffing levels.
- Swap Shifts: Allow employees to swap shifts with one another, provided it doesn't disrupt your scheduling needs.

Communicating Schedule Changes
Regularly update your employees about any changes to the schedule. You can do this by emailing the updated schedule, posting it in a shared workspace, or using a group chat app. Encourage employees to check the schedule regularly and notify you of any conflicts or concerns.
To minimize confusion, consider using a consistent format for communicating schedule changes. For example, you might use a specific color or font to indicate new shifts, changes, or cancellations.
Monitoring Attendance and Hours
Use your free printable employee schedules to track employee attendance and hours worked. This will help you ensure that your business is adequately staffed and that employees are working the hours they've been scheduled for.
You can also use this information to calculate employee wages, generate payroll reports, and monitor labor costs. To streamline this process, consider using time-tracking software or apps that integrate with your scheduling system.
Optimizing Staffing Levels
Regularly review your free printable employee schedules to ensure you have the right number of employees scheduled for each shift. This will help you maintain adequate staffing levels, minimize overtime, and improve overall productivity.
To optimize staffing levels, consider using historical data to predict future demand, adjusting schedules based on sales projections, and cross-training employees to fill multiple roles.
